Holocaust survivor and ‘proud gay man’ shares inspirational coming out story: ‘It was beyond liberating’

 | 
12/25/2022

A Jewish man who lived through the horrors of the Holocaust has shared his heart-warming story of finally feeling able to come out as gay in his 50s. Sacha Kester recalled how living through the atrocity, in which an estimated 5-15,000 men were sent to concentration camps for the ‘crime’ of being homosexual, left him fearful of coming out when he realised he was gay. Writing for Metro.co.uk, Kester said: “It was during my teenage years that I realised I was attracted to men. I found myself falling for guys, but always in secret – so, of course, it was unrequited love. “Back in those days, it didn’t seem to be a possibility to be openly gay. To have a gay relationship was illegal and frowned upon – and it was hard for me knowing that gay men were persecuted for their sexuality during the Holocaust.  “For this reason, it just never occurred to me that I could explore any sort of gay lifestyle.”
